The scholarship, valued at $1,000, is funded through gifts made by college faculty and staff members and is awarded to students based on academic achievement.
The students receiving the scholarships will be recognized during the fall commencement ceremony at 7:30 p.m. Oct. 9 in the Johnny Mercer Theatre.
According to Verlene Lampley, vice president for student success and scholarship committee chair, the thirteen recipients represent the largest number of scholarships awarded during a given year.
“We are very pleased with the growth of the scholarship over the past three years,” Lampley said. “Our faculty and staff are to be commended for their continued support of this scholarship.”
